De distributie maakt geen gebruik van traditionele pakketbeheerders, maar biedt in plaats daarvan een minimaal, atomair bijwerkbaar, alleen-lezen basissysteem dat is gebouwd met behulp van tooling
Endless OS is een van de distributies die innovatie onder Linux-gebruikerssystemen bevordert. De desktopomgeving in Endless OS is gebaseerd op een aanzienlijk opnieuw ontworpen fork van GNOME. Tegelijkertijd nemen Endless-ontwikkelaars actief deel aan de ontwikkeling van upstream-projecten en geven hun ontwikkelingen aan hen door. In de GTK+ 3.22-release was bijvoorbeeld ongeveer 9.8% van alle wijzigingen doorgevoerd
In de nieuwe uitgave:
- Desktop- en distributiecomponenten (mutter, gnome-settings-daemon, nautilus, etc.) zijn overgebracht naar GNOME 3.32-technologieën (de vorige versie van de desktop was een fork van GNOME 3.28). Er wordt gebruik gemaakt van de Linux 5.0-kernel. De systeemomgeving is gesynchroniseerd met de pakketbasis van Debian 10 “Buster”;
- Er is een ingebouwde mogelijkheid om geïsoleerde containers van Docker Hub en andere registers te installeren, en om afbeeldingen van een Dockerfile te bouwen. Inclusief Podman, dat een Docker-compatibele opdrachtregelinterface biedt voor het beheren van geïsoleerde containers;
- Minder schijfruimte verbruikt bij het installeren van een pakket. Terwijl voorheen het pakket eerst werd gedownload en vervolgens naar een aparte map werd gekopieerd, wat resulteerde in duplicatie op schijf, wordt de installatie nu rechtstreeks uitgevoerd zonder een extra kopieerfase. De nieuwe modus is ontwikkeld door Endless in samenwerking met Red Hat en overgedragen aan het hoofdteam van Flatpak;
- Ondersteuning voor de mobiele Android-app is stopgezet;
- Er is gezorgd voor een visueel consistenter ontwerp van het opstartproces, zonder flikkeringen bij het wisselen van modus op systemen met Intel GPU's;
- Ondersteuning voor grafische tablets van Wacom is bijgewerkt en er zijn nieuwe opties toegevoegd voor het instellen en gebruiken ervan.
Bron: opennet.ru